EXMAR is an innovative ship owner providing solutions for the operation, transportation and transformation of gaseous molecules. At EXMAR, we value your energy. EXMAR is an equal opportunity employer that is committed to inclusion and diversity. EXMAR originated from a small shipyard on the river Scheldt in 1829, evolving into a major industrial wharf by the early 20th century. End 1970's, EXMAR entered the gas sector, beginning with the delivery of its first LNG carrier. During the 1980s and 1990s, EXMAR expanded its gas carrier activities and also entering the LNG and Offshore markets. Today, EXMAR is a key player in the global energy value chain, transitioning from a traditional shipping company to an innovative gas energy provider.
